Telephone Operators in Morgantown, WV earn an average of $37,856 per year, with most salaries falling between $30,285 and $45,427 depending on experience, employer, and specialization. At 9% below the national average, Morgantown offers a more modest rate for this role, in part reflecting a local cost of living index of 82. A gross salary of $37,856 for a Telephone Operators in Morgantown translates to roughly $2,303 in monthly take-home pay after estimated federal and state taxes. Set against monthly living costs of $2,124—covering housing, food, transportation, utilities, and healthcare—that leaves approximately $179 per month in disposable income. That margin, not the gross number, is what determines whether you can comfortably cover rent, build savings, and afford discretionary spending in Morgantown's current market.
